Output edfda29024da106bd71ff146119859eabf604ecc68de6eed590c74e5aa8b6118:0

value
2086980
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 75a7cb17b63f4e655265eff484fed95884150d2d OP_EQUALVERIFY OP_CHECKSIG
address
1Bj74vtg3Mso14BF563LWhKGsQ9DtZnGM7
transaction
edfda29024da106bd71ff146119859eabf604ecc68de6eed590c74e5aa8b6118
spent
true